關於Oracle歸檔與非歸檔 存檔 模式命令

2021-08-31 22:47:13 字數 1841 閱讀 8308

sql**

sqlplus /nolog;  

sqlplus /nolog;
sql**

conn /assysdba;  

conn / as sysdba;
這樣就進入了sqlplus的裡面;如果你的資料庫處於開啟狀態,那麼請執行:

sql**

shutdown immediate;  

shutdown immediate;
執行完以後的步驟後,就要開始進行歸檔模式與非歸檔模式之間的轉換了:

sql**

startup mount;  

startup mount;
歸檔->非歸檔

sql**

alter

databasenoarchivelog;  

alter database noarchivelog;
非歸檔->歸檔

sql**

alter

databasearchivelog;  

alter database archivelog;
檢查是否成功:

sql**

archive log list;  

遇到上面問題請在oracle\product\10.2.0\db_1\network\admin目錄下找到listener.ora檔案,然後修改

sid_list_listener =

(sid_list =

(sid_desc =

(sid_name = pl***tproc)

(oracle_home = e:\oracle10\product\10.2.0\db_1)

(program = extproc)))

listener =

(description_list =

(description =

(address = (protocol = ipc)(key = extproc1))

(address = (protocol = tcp)(host = test-hj)(port = 1521))))

為:sid_list_listener =

(sid_list =

(sid_desc =

(sid_name = pl***tproc)

(oracle_home = e:\oracle10\product\10.2.0\db_1)

(program = extproc)

)(sid_desc   =

(global_dbname   =   orcl)

(oracle_home   =   e:\oracle\product\10.2.0\db_1)      

(sid_name   =   orcl)))

listener =

(description_list =

(description =

(address = (protocol = ipc)(key = extproc1))

(address = (protocol = tcp)(host = test-hj)(port = 1521))))

上述sid為orcl,如果為其他sid請填寫對應sid即可,儲存並覆蓋原有檔案,重啟例項後再執行上面的命令即可。

Oracle歸檔模式與非歸檔模式

oracle歸檔模式與非歸檔模式 一。檢視oracle資料庫是否為歸檔模式 1 1.select name,log mode from v database name log mode query noarchivelog 2.使用archive log list 命令 database log m...

Oracle歸檔模式與非歸檔模式設定

oracle歸檔模式與非歸檔模式設定 oracle的日誌歸檔模式可以有效的防止instance和disk的故障,在資料庫故障恢復中不可或缺,由於oracle初始安裝模式為非歸檔模式,因此需要將其設定為歸檔模式,下面就其方法和步驟做一些總結,雖然簡單,但這是管理oracle資料庫必備之工,故有如下陳述...

oracle中歸檔模式與非歸檔模式之間的轉換

如果目前你的資料庫處於未開啟狀態,那麼請執行 在 執行 裡面輸入cmd,進到dos介面後輸入下面 sqlplus nolog conn as sysdba 這樣就進入了sqlplus的裡面 如果你的資料庫處於開啟狀態,那麼請執行 shutdown immediate 執行完以後的步驟後,就要開始進行...